    While the Entourage movie is still to hit the theatres, producer Mark Wahlberg is already planning the sequel of the film. Mark has apparently made it clear to the director that waiting for the release would do no help since he’s too confident of the success of the project.

    The 43 years old actor/producer is very excited about the entire deal. "I told (director) Doug (Ellin), `Let`s not wait for the movie to come out to start planning the next one because this is definitely going to be a big success” said a very enthusiastic Mark. He continued showering praises for the film, "Entourage`, I just saw the movie. It`s fantastic. The stakes are so big. You`re rooting for these guys to succeed. There`s so much humor and heart in it and Doug just did an amazing job” said Mark. While the Entourage movie is to open next year on June 12, Wahlberg’s push for things to move may pace everything up. Entourage as the HBO TV series has been extremely successful adding millions of fans worldwide. The story is even believed to be loosely based on Wahlberg’s struggle for being an actor. The movie starts off where the last season ended with the original TV cast Adrian Grenier, Kevin Connolly, Kevin Dillon, Jeremy Piven, and Jerry Ferrara continuing their roles.

    ‘The Italian Job’ actor also spoke of his willingness to start the sequel soon, "I don`t think we`re going to be able to wait a year to release the movie. We`re going to show the studio sooner, rather than later. If it makes most sense to wait until June, we`ll wait until June," he added.
